Product details

Overview

SLWRB4181B from Silicon Labs is a plug-in radio board for EFR32xG21 2.4 GHz wireless development, featuring the EFR32MG21A010F1024IM32 SoC (1024 kB Flash, 96 kB RAM), inverted-F PCB antenna, 10 dBm RF output, and dual user LEDs (red/green). It enables rapid prototyping of Bluetooth Low Energy and Zigbee mesh applications when paired with BRD4001A or BRD4002A mainboards.

Technical Context

The SLWRB4181B implements the EFR32MG21A010F1024IM32 Wireless Gecko SoC - a 2.4 GHz, 10 dBm transceiver with ARM Cortex-M33 core, supporting Bluetooth 5.2, Zigbee 3.0, and Thread 1.3 protocols. Its RF path integrates matching network and inverted-F PCB antenna tuned for 2.400–2.4835 GHz operation.

Hardware integration relies on standardized mechanical and electrical interfaces: it mates with BRD4001A/BRD4002A mainboards via 60-pin edge connector, exposes EFR32 I/O through top/bottom breakout pads, and routes key signals (SWD, VCOM, PTI) to dedicated headers including Simplicity Connector and Mini Simplicity Connector.

Key Specifications

Parameter Value and Actual Design Meaning
Core SoC EF R32MG21A010F1024IM32: ARM Cortex-M33, 1024 kB Flash, 96 kB RAM, 78.4 MHz max clock
RF Frequency Band 2.400–2.4835 GHz ISM band - supports global Bluetooth LE, Zigbee, and Thread deployments
Output Power 10 dBm - sufficient for typical indoor mesh node range without external PA
Antenna Type Inverted-F PCB antenna - integrated, no external antenna required, optimized for 50 Ω impedance match
Mainboard Compatibility BRD4001A (Wireless Starter Kit) and BRD4002A (Wireless Pro Kit) - full J-Link, VCOM, AEM, and PTI support
Debug Interfaces J-Link USB/Ethernet, SWD, Packet Trace Interface (PTI), Virtual COM Port - all routed to Simplicity/Mini Simplicity connectors
Power Monitoring Advanced Energy Monitor (AEM) - real-time current/voltage profiling with µA resolution, traceable to VMCU rail

FAQ

What is the SLWRB4181B used for?

The SLWRB4181B is a radio board that plugs into BRD4001A or BRD4002A mainboards to form a complete EFR32xG21 development kit. It hosts the EFR32MG21A010F1024IM32 SoC and provides RF functionality, LED indicators, and I/O access - enabling firmware development, protocol validation, and power profiling for Bluetooth LE, Zigbee, and Thread applications. The SLWRB4181B itself is not standalone; it requires a compatible mainboard to operate.

Does the SLWRB4181B include an onboard debugger?

No, the SLWRB4181B does not contain its own debugger. Debugging is provided by the mainboard (BRD4001A or BRD4002A), which integrates a SEGGER J-Link debugger supporting SWD, Virtual COM Port, Packet Trace Interface, and Advanced Energy Monitor. The SLWRB4181B connects to these features via its edge connector and exposes them through headers like Simplicity Connector and Mini Simplicity Connector.

Which EFR32 device is mounted on the SLWRB4181B?

The SLWRB4181B mounts the EFR32MG21A010F1024IM32 - a 2.4 GHz Wireless Gecko SoC with ARM Cortex-M33 core, 1024 kB Flash, 96 kB RAM, 10 dBm output power, and hardware acceleration for AES, ECC, and SHA. This exact part number is confirmed in UG429 Section 1.1 and BRD4181B feature list.

Can the SLWRB4181B be used with both BRD4001A and BRD4002A mainboards?

Yes, the SLWRB4181B is mechanically and electrically compatible with both BRD4001A (Wireless Starter Kit Mainboard) and BRD4002A (Wireless Pro Kit Mainboard). However, pin mapping to breakout pads differs between mainboards, and certain features - such as logic analyzer, joystick, and variable VMCU - are exclusive to BRD4002A. UG429 explicitly confirms SLWRB4181B usage with either mainboard.

What software tools support the SLWRB4181B?

The SLWRB4181B is fully supported by Silicon Labs Simplicity Studio - including Energy Profiler for current measurement, Network Analyzer for packet inspection, and SDKs for Bluetooth LE, Zigbee, and Thread. Firmware examples, bootloader tools, and GCC/IAR/ARM compiler integration are all validated for the EFR32MG21A010F1024IM32 on SLWRB4181B.
